Psychotherapy describes a range of treatments that can assist with psychological health issue, psychological obstacles, and also some psychiatric problems.

It aims to allow clients, or customers, to understand their sensations, as well as what makes them feel positive, distressed, or dispirited. This can equip them to deal with difficult situations in a much more adaptive method.

Commonly, the training course of treatment lasts under 1 year; individuals who are eager to transform and willing to place in Article source the effort typically report positive results.

Psychotherapy can provide help with a range of troubles, from clinical depression and also reduced self-confidence to addiction and also family disagreements. Anyone that is really feeling overwhelmed by their problems and not able to cope might be able to benefit from psychotherapy.

Combined with medicine, it can contribute in dealing with bipolar disorder and schizophrenia.

What to anticipate

Psychotherapy is often called "the chatting cure."

Psychotherapy is in some cases called a "chatting treatment" since it makes use of speaking, instead of medicine.

Some forms of psychiatric therapy last just a couple of sessions, while others are long-lasting, lasting for months or years. Sessions are typically for 1 hour, once a week, and they follow a carefully organized procedure.

Procedure might be one-to-one, in pairs, or in groups. Techniques can include other forms of communication, such as drama, narrative story, or songs.

A therapist might be a psycho therapist, a marital relationship and also family therapist, a qualified professional social worker or mental health and wellness therapist, a psychiatric nurse practitioner, psychoanalyst, or psychiatrist.

Kinds

There are a variety of designs and techniques in psychiatric therapy:

Behavioral therapy

Behavioral therapy assists clients to understand how adjustments in behavior can bring about modifications in just how they really feel. It concentrates on boosting the individual's interaction in favorable or socially reinforcing activities.

The strategy examines what the client is doing, and then tries to increase the possibility of having favorable experiences.

The objective is for preferable habits reactions to change unfavorable ones.

Behavioral therapy can aid individuals whose emotional distress comes from habits that they participate in.

Cognitive therapy

Cognitive therapy begins with the idea that what we believe forms how we really feel.

Anxiety, as an example, may stem from having ideas or ideas that are not based on proof, such as "I am pointless," or "Everything fails as a result of me."

Altering these beliefs can alter an individual's sight of events, and their emotional state.

Cognitive treatment looks at present thinking and also interaction patterns, as opposed to the past.

The specialist deals with the customer to confront and challenge unacceptable ideas by urging different ways of viewing a scenario.

Cognitive therapy can aid in dealing with problems such as trauma (PTSD).

Cognitive behavior modification (CBT) pairs cognitive with behavior modification, to attend to both thoughts as well as behaviors.

Social treatment

Psychotherapy can include motion, drama as well as music, can aid individuals of any type of age, and also can be done in teams, pairs, or individually.

This method concentrates on interpersonal partnerships.

Clinical depression, for example, might originate from an individual's connection with others. Discovering abilities for enhancing interaction patterns might help the customer to take care of the clinical depression.

Initially, the specialist might help the customer to determine appropriate feelings, and also where these are originating from. After that they can help them to reveal the feelings in a much healthier method.

As an example, someone that reacts to feeling neglected by snapping may cause an adverse response in an enjoyed one.

Finding out to express the pain and stress and anxiety comfortably can raise the possibilities of the various other individual reacting favorably.

The client learns to customize their approach to interpersonal troubles, recognize them, as well as manage them more constructively.

Individuals that may benefit from this kind of treatment consist of individuals that are eager to please others at their own cost, or that locate that they have volatile interpersonal relationships.
